打码7怎么改成9,收款码设备码这些怎么改?

打码7怎么改成9,收款码设备码这些怎么改?

在数字支付浪潮席卷的今天,二维码以其便捷、高效的特点,已然成为连接商业与消费的桥梁。然而,伴随其普及,一些大胆的设想也随之浮现:能否将一个收款码中的数字“7”通过物理或数字手段修改为“9”?收款码、设备码这些看似静态的图像,其背后是否存在着可被“编辑”的空间?这些问题触及了二维码技术的核心,也关乎着整个数字支付体系的安全基石。要解答这些疑问,我们必须抛开表象,深入探究二维码的内在构造与运行逻辑。

首先,我们需要理解,一个二维码并非简单的图片,它是一部高度结构化的微型数据编码器。其表面看似随机分布的黑白方块,实则遵循着严谨的国际标准(如ISO/IEC 18004)。一个标准的二维码由多个关键部分构成:三个角落的“回”字形定位图案,用于帮助扫描设备快速识别和定位;纵横交错的定时图案,帮助确定二维码的模块坐标;对齐图案,用于校正较大尺寸二维码可能产生的图像畸变。而最核心的,则是被这些功能图案包围的数据区与纠错区。数据区以二进制码字的形式存储着实际信息,比如一个网址、一段文本,或是收款码所对应的唯一账户标识符。纠错区则存储着基于 Reed-Solomon 算法生成的纠错码字,这正是二维码容错性的秘密所在。

现在,让我们回到最初的问题:将“7”改成“9”。在二维码的编码世界里,数字“7”和“9”是通过不同的二进制序列来表示的。要将“7”改成“9”,意味着需要改变数据区中一系列的模块(即黑白方块)状态。这听起来似乎不难,用记号笔涂改几个方块即可。但问题在于,你修改的不仅仅是数据,更是破坏了整个二维码的数学完整性。二维码的纠错机制,其设计初衷是为了应对物理污染、褶皱、部分遮挡等非恶意的物理损伤,它允许在一定程度的错误范围内,通过纠错码字反向推算出原始的正确数据。这个容错率分为L、M、Q、H四个等级,分别对应约7%、15%、25%、30%的损坏面积可修复。将“7”改成“9”,所需修改的模块数量往往远超其纠错能力上限。扫描设备在解码时,会发现数据码字与纠错码字之间的数学关系不成立,当错误数量超出阈值,解码过程便会宣告失败。这就像一本加密日记,你不仅改动了正文,还破坏了书末的校验密码,任何人尝试解读都会发现内容自相矛盾,从而判定其为无效信息。

更进一步,我们讨论的收款码与设备码,其安全性远不止于纠错机制。收款码,尤其是静态个人收款码,它本质上是一个指向你支付账户的“链接”。这个链接本身就是一个唯一的、在支付服务商(如微信、支付宝)服务器上注册过的字符串。当你扫描这个码时,你的手机应用只是将这个字符串提取出来,然后发送给支付服务商的服务器。服务器进行验证,确认这是一个有效且激活的收款账户,才会弹出支付界面。这意味着,即使你通过某种极其高超的技术手段,成功地将一个二维码中的数据串A修改为另一个已存在的数据串B,当用户扫描时,款项依然会流向数据串B所对应的原始账户,而非你的账户。你所做的,无异于将别人家的门牌号“101室”改成“102室”,试图让快递员把包裹送给你,但快递员(支付服务器)的系统里,102室的收件人信息是固定的,包裹最终还是会被送到正确的收件人手中。这种架构设计,决定了恶意修改收款码在逻辑上是徒劳的,因为价值的流向由后端数据库的记录决定,而非前端的二维码图像本身。

至于设备码,其安全性则更为严密。设备码通常用于绑定特定硬件(如POS机、扫码枪)与商户账户,它往往是动态生成或与硬件物理特征绑定的。这类码包含的信息可能包括设备序列号、硬件密钥、认证令牌等敏感数据。它们的设计目标就是确保“一机一码”,防止设备被仿冒或滥用。试图修改设备码,就如同试图修改汽车的发动机识别号(VIN),不仅技术难度极高,而且在任何正规系统中都会立即触发安全警报,导致设备被锁定或账户被冻结。现代支付系统普遍采用多重加密和动态令牌技术,每一次通信都可能包含时间戳和一次性验证码,这使得即便截获了某个瞬间的数据,也无法用于下一次交易或伪造新的有效二维码。

那么,在现实的商业活动中,如果商户的收款码因污损、打印错误或更换账户需要更新时,正确的路径是什么?答案并非去“修改”,而是“重新生成”。无论是个人还是商户,都可以通过官方支付应用轻松生成全新的收款码。这个过程会向服务器申请一个新的、唯一的账户链接,并将其编码成全新的二维码图像。对于有品牌定制需求的商户,也可以使用官方提供的或合规的第三方工具,在保证纠错等级(通常建议选择M或Q级以平衡美观与可靠性)的前提下,将企业Logo巧妙地嵌入到二维码的特定区域(通常是中间位置,因为此处有最少的数据和纠错信息)。这才是既安全又符合规范的“修改”方式,它是在规则框架内进行的美化与创新,而非对底层安全协议的挑战。

二维码技术的精妙之处,在于它将复杂的数字身份浓缩于一个简单的图形之中,同时通过数学与架构的双重保险,确保了身份的唯一性与不可篡改性。这种特性,恰恰是构建数字信任的基石。每一张小小的收款码背后,都承载着用户对支付系统的信任,对交易安全的期待。试图破解或修改它,不仅是技术上的徒劳,更是对这种信任体系的侵蚀。与其将精力投入到如何“走捷径”的幻想中,不如深入理解其工作原理,学会如何更好地利用它,如何通过正规渠道管理好自己的数字资产,在安全、便捷的轨道上,享受数字经济带来的红利。二维码的真正力量不在于其表面的可塑性,而在于其内在的数字契约——一个与后端系统牢不可破的链接。与其试图挑战这一契约,不如学会如何在其规则内,安全、高效地驾驭数字商业的浪潮。